Daredevil (2016 Series 1-4): Charles Soule truly begins his run with Ron Garney on art, with Matt Milla providing colors, Soule's writing is solid so far, setting up a new era of DD with Matt back in black, alongside having a sidekick of sorts now, named Blindspot!
All New All Different Point One (Daredevil Story): Charles Soule's DD run begins here with a 8 page teaser that basically just sets up a new character for this run, Blindspot!
Daredevil Cold Day in Hell 1-3: Charles Soule & Steve McNiven (with Dean White for colors on issues 2-3) team up for what's essentially a Dark Knight Returns homage with Daredevil. I will be honest, story wise I've seen it before, but McNiven nails Miller's style from the 80s perfectly.

I got a copy of Daredevil Back in Black today, which is a new first volume of a 3 volume printing of Charles Soule's DD run! However what I was pleasantly surprised to see was this comic is seemingly in a new format for marvel, at least for TPBs this size!
